My house in Fredericktown has original plumbing from the 1940s. What should I expect at this age?

Galvanized steel pipes installed around 1948 are now 78 years old. Homeowners in Fredericktown often notice reduced water pressure and rust-colored water as the interior walls corrode and narrow. This corrosion accelerates after 70 years, leading to frequent leaks at threaded joints. Replacing sections with modern materials like copper or PEX becomes necessary to maintain reliable water flow.

As a rural homeowner, what unique plumbing issues should I watch for?

Rural properties often rely on wells and septic systems that require specific maintenance. Well pumps need regular checks for pressure consistency, while septic tanks should be pumped every 3-5 years to prevent backups. These systems differ from municipal setups and benefit from specialized servicing.

Could the hilly land around Ten Mile Creek affect my drainage?

Hilly slopes near Ten Mile Creek create drainage challenges that stress main sewer lines. Soil erosion can expose or damage underground pipes, while gravity flow issues may cause backups in lower elevations. Proper grading and periodic camera inspections help identify problems before they become emergencies.

Does hard water from the Monongahela River damage my plumbing?

Hard water from the Monongahela River causes scale buildup inside pipes and appliances. Water heaters accumulate mineral deposits that reduce efficiency and shorten lifespan. Fixtures like faucets and showerheads develop clogs that require regular cleaning or replacement to maintain proper function.

Why do my old pipes keep springing small leaks?

Galvanized steel from 1948 develops pinhole leaks as corrosion eats through the pipe walls over decades. Joint calcification also occurs where mineral deposits weaken connections. These failures are common in aging systems and often require complete repiping rather than temporary patches to prevent recurring problems.

What should I do before spring thaw to avoid plumbing problems?

Insulate exposed pipes in crawl spaces and basements before temperatures drop to 21°F. Disconnect garden hoses and shut off exterior water valves to prevent freeze damage. Check for leaks after thaw cycles, as temperature fluctuations can stress older pipe joints in our temperate climate.
